About the CISSP Exam

The gold standard in information security management

The (ISC)² Certified Information Systems Security Professional certification validates expertise in designing, implementing, and managing a best-in-class cybersecurity programme across eight domains of security knowledge.

Who Should Take This Exam?

The CISSP is designed for experienced professionals seeking advanced validation. 2+ years of hands-on experience recommended.

Prerequisites: 5 years security experience (or 4 + degree)

Typical study time: 8-12 weeks of intensive study

Exam Domains & Weights

The CISSP exam covers 8 domains. Focus your study time based on the weights below — higher-weighted domains have more exam questions.

DomainWeightPractice Qs
Security and Risk Management16%32
Asset Security10%20
Security Architecture and Engineering13%26
Communication and Network Security13%26
Identity and Access Management (IAM)13%26
Security Assessment and Testing12%24
Security Operations13%26
Software Development Security10%20
Total100%200

💡 Study tip: Security and Risk Management carries the most weight (16%) — start there. Asset Security has the least (10%), but don’t skip it — exam questions can come from any domain.

ISC² Certification Path

Start with CC (Certified in Cybersecurity) for entry-level, then SSCP for technical security, then CISSP for management. CISSP concentrations (ISSAP, ISSEP, ISSMP) come after CISSP.
